My first logo design went from $50 to $500 in 6 months flat

So I landed my very first freelance gig designing a logo for a local bakery in Austin. I charged them $50 because I had zero clue what I was doing and just wanted a portfolio piece. Fast forward 6 months later, I got a referral from that same bakery owner to a tech startup. I asked for $500 on a whim and they said yes without even negotiating. What changed was I had actual examples of work to show, so I didn't feel like I was guessing anymore.
